The US Somatostatin Analogs Ssas Market market size was valued at approximately USD 600.0 million in 2025 and is projected to reach USD 900.0 million by 2035, growing at a CAGR of 3.8% during the forecast period. This market is a pivotal section of the healthcare sector, primarily focusing on gastrointestinal and endocrinological applications. Somatostatin analogs are peptide hormone mimics, used in the management of conditions such as acromegaly, neuroendocrine tumors, and Cushing's syndrome by inhibiting excessive hormone secretion.

Octreotide – 45%: Octreotide is a long-acting somatostatin analog often used due to its efficacy in treating acromegaly and its availability in various formulations.
Lanreotide – 35%: Lanreotide maintains a significant share owing to its success in treating neuroendocrine tumors and preferential prescription due to fewer side effects.
Pasireotide – 20%: Pasireotide addresses more niche applications but still contributes due to its specialized role in Cushing's disease management.
